Review of Metal Roof Covering



Steel roof covering has actually obtained appeal over the last few years as a result of its durability and aesthetic allure. When you select steel roofing, you're selecting a material that can hold up against extreme climate condition, consisting of heavy rainfall, snow, and high winds.

Unlike traditional tiles, metal roofings can last 40 to 70 years with minimal upkeep, making them a long-lasting investment.

Another advantage of metal roof is its energy efficiency. You'll discover that lots of metal roofing systems are made to mirror solar warmth, which can help in reducing your cooling costs during hot summertime.


And also, metal roofings are typically made from recycled materials, which attract eco aware property owners.

In terms of design, steel roofing is available in various styles, colors, and surfaces, permitting you to tailor your home's look. Whether you favor a smooth modern-day appearance or a rustic charm, you'll have options to match your vision.

Ultimately, metal roof covering is immune to pests and rot, providing you comfort that your roofing system will certainly continue to be intact throughout the years.

Key Comparisons and Factors To Consider



Picking between metal and shingle roof involves a number of key comparisons and considerations that can dramatically impact your choice.

First, think of longevity. Metal roof coverings can last 40 to 70 years, while asphalt shingles typically last 15 to three decades. This longevity means that although steel might have a higher in advance expense, it might conserve you money in the future.

Next, consider maintenance. Metal roofing systems call for much less upkeep, withstanding mold and mold, while roof shingles might require a lot more constant inspections and repairs.

Weather condition resistance is one more essential element. Steel roof coverings take care of harsh weather well, consisting of heavy rain and snow, whereas tiles can be vulnerable to wind damages.

Looks also play a role. Shingles provide a standard appearance that many home owners favor, while metal roof covering is available in numerous styles and shades, permitting even more customization.

Last but not least, evaluate insulation and energy performance. Steel roof coverings mirror warm, keeping your home cooler, while tiles may soak up much more warm, influencing your energy bills.
